Memorandum of Law in Support of the Motion of VPIRG to Intervene as Defendant
On December 30, 2025, Campaign Legal Center along with the Brennan Center for Justice and Wilschek Iarrapino filed on behalf of Vermont Public Interest Research Group (VPIRG) a motion to intervene as defendant in United States v. Copeland Hanzas. In that case, the Department of Justice has sued Vermont’s secretary of state for failing to turn over information, including sensitive voter data. VPIRG works to mobilize Vermonters to protect and strengthen democracy in the state and represents thousands of members across Vermont whose personal information may now be unlawfully shared depending on the outcome of this litigation.
